Fossil
Fossil is a version-control tool that distributed version control system with built-in wiki, bug tracking, and web interface in a single executable. It is open source software.
vs
AS
Apache Subversion
Apache Subversion Centralized version control system widely used in enterprise environments for managing files and directories over time.
